Output 010174f1473fcec4b7522adb63d38c5804fa9b78f81ce0a4a47ca6fbba9f964c:24

value
50184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5aefbcdbcfae7aa9e65bb7bce0f31cac4fc0e62 OP_EQUAL
address
3KiGfQeiZt3GrV3WP74X2mm55BrEma3v1R
transaction
010174f1473fcec4b7522adb63d38c5804fa9b78f81ce0a4a47ca6fbba9f964c
confirmations
131740
spent
true